As the intelligent core of automatic transmissions, the Transmission Control Unit (TCU) has its product functions systematically divided into the following technical modules:
1. Shift Logic Control
① Dynamic Gear Decision-Making
·Analyzes parameters such as vehicle speed, engine speed, and throttle opening in real time, and selects the optimal shift timing according to preset algorithms (e.g., early upshifting in economy mode / delayed downshifting in sport mode).
· Supports multi-mode switching (economy/sport/snow, etc.) and adapts to different driving needs by adjusting shift curves.
② Actuator Coordination
·Controls solenoid valves to switch hydraulic oil circuits and drives clutches/brakes to complete gear changes, with a response speed of 10-50ms.
·Coordinates the actions of two sets of clutches in dual-clutch transmissions to achieve power-shift without interruption.
2 .Powertrain Optimization
① Improvement of Transmission Efficiency
· Reduces energy loss through torque converter lock-up control, increasing transmission efficiency by 5-8%.
·The adaptive learning function optimizes shift strategies according to driving habits (e.g., extending gear holding time during aggressive driving).
② Torque Coordination Management
· Links with the ECU to adjust engine ignition timing and reduce shift shock.
· Coordinates the output of the motor and transmission in hybrid models.
3. System Monitoring and Protection
① Fault Diagnosis
·Monitors parameters such as oil pressure and oil temperature in real time. When abnormalities occur, it stores DTC codes and triggers a fault light alarm.
·Supports Limp Home mode, which limits gears to ensure emergency driving of the vehicle.
② Communication Integration
·Shares data with systems such as ECU and ESP through the CAN bus to realize the coordination of the vehicle's powertrain.
4. Special Function Expansion
·Parking Logic: Automatically activates P-gear locking when the vehicle speed is below 2km/h.
·New Energy Adaptation: Integrates motor control algorithms in pure electric vehicles.
